which is the most accurate setting for the Korg CA-20 tuner ?




Tagged As: Korg Tuner

Question:
I noticed that the Korg CA-20 tuner has calibration settings ranging from 430-449 Hz. Changing this setting seems to change the tuning. What is the purpose of this and which is the most accurate setting?

Answer:
I have one of those tuners also.. I don't know what they are for but 440 is the tuning that is standard pitch for piano. 440 is most appropriate; all are accurate Others are useful if you get a call to accompany a European orchestra. I believe many pitch their A higher than 440
